Quick Answer: How Much Is A Tour De France Bike
If you’re after a ballpark figure of the cost of a Tour de France bike, then around £11,000 / $13,000 / AU$18,000 per bike is a safe round-number estimate, but let’s dive deeper for a detailed look.
How much does a Tour de France bike cost 2020?
It Will Cost You About $12,000. The Tour de France is not just the biggest cycling race of the year—it’s also the biggest stage for sponsors and manufacturers to officially unveil their newest carbon fiber dream machines.

How much do the bikes weigh in the Tour de France?
Today, bikes weigh in at just under 15 pounds—but not any lower, since the UCI’s minimum bike weight is 6.8kg, which translates to 14.99 pounds. Why aren’t there more Americans in the Tour?Jul 24, 2020
How much money do you get for winning the Tour de France?
The Tour de France is undoubtedly the biggest and most prestigious cycling race in the world, but the prize money doesn’t really stack up. The winner of the three week stage race takes home just under (AU) $800,000, while each stage winner earns (AU) $17,541.

Is 20 mph on a bike fast?
Average speed – indications Most cyclists can achieve 10-12 mph average very quickly with limited training. Reasonable experience, medium (say 40 miles): average around 16-19 mph. Quite competent club rider, some regular training likely, medium-long distances (say 50-60 miles): 20-24 mph.
